WebClass 1: Specifies that there will be no dye applied to the finished part. Class 2: Specifies that there will be a dye applied to the finished part during the hard anodizing process. Base Materials that MIL-A-8625 Anodize Type III hard coat anodizing can be applied include 1100, 3000, 5000, 6000, and 7000 series aluminum alloys. WebMIL-A-8625 Becomes MIL-PRF-8625 The popular anodising specification MIL-A-8625 has been up-issued and renamed MIL-PRF-8625 (issue F2), with immediate effect. This notice is to let you and relevant departments know of the above change, if using this specification please can you ensure the new standard is referenced on future purchase orders.
